Exotic Pets: Columbus vs Dublin

How do exotic pets rules compare between Columbus, OH and Dublin, OH?

Columbus and Dublin have similar restriction levels.

Columbus, OH

Franklin County

Heavy Restrictions

Ohio's Dangerous Wild Animal Act (ORC 935) prohibits private ownership of big cats, bears, non-human primates, large constrictor snakes, crocodilians, and similar species throughout Franklin County. The 2012 law followed the Zanesville incident and is enforced by ODA.

Dublin, OH

Franklin County

Heavy Restrictions

Ohio prohibits most dangerous wild animals under ORC 935 (Dangerous Wild Animal Act). Dublin follows state law; big cats, bears, primates, and venomous snakes are banned.
